  1. 01

    The Legal Floor Under Your Transatlantic Architecture Just Cracked — Plan for No DPF

    monitor

    The pattern is the argument. Safe Harbor lasted 15 years, Privacy Shield 4, and the current DPF is on pace to fall in roughly 3. Each successor was built on weaker foundations than the last. What breaks the chain this time is not policy. EU treaty law requires oversight by independent authorities. The European Commission's implementing decision names the FTC as one of them. The Supreme Court has now ruled the statutory independence protecting FTC commissioners unconstitutional. EU law demands what US constitutional law now prohibits.

    That forecloses the usual repairs. Prior invalidations were patched with executive orders and rebrands. A constitutional ruling cannot be, and a congressional fix reconstructing agency independence is improbable. The supporting infrastructure is decaying on the same timeline. The PCLOB, which oversees the framework's Data Protection Review Court, has lacked a quorum since January 2025. The strongest counterargument — that FTC independence wasn't 'central' to the adequacy decision — is technically arguable, but don't bet your architecture on a European court accepting it.

    Second-Order Effects

    Data localization moves from conservative compliance posture to necessary architectural bet. Every EU sovereignty signal points one direction. AI residency requirements now go beyond data residency. Sovereign-cloud mandates are already forcing open-source stacks at European banks and rail operators. Inference infrastructure is fragmenting nationally the way storage did after GDPR. Firms assuming centralized US processing face a rearchitecture tax. Firms investing in regional infrastructure now convert that compliance cost into a sales advantage in regulated European markets.

    The Decision

    1. Treat this as an 18-36 month structural risk with a 6-month activation window. The contingency has to be executable fast when the CJEU moves, not designed after it.
    2. Standard Contractual Clauses and binding corporate rules are the fallback, but they inherit the same surveillance-law objections. They buy time, not immunity.
    The Bottom Line — For the third time in a decade, the legal basis for moving European data to the US is dying, and this time no executive order can resurrect it.

  2. 02

    Machine-Speed Offense Met Ungoverned Agents Today — Your Security Model Assumed Neither

    act now

    The pattern this week is structural, not a run of unlucky bugs. GhostApproval escapes workspace sandboxes through Unix symlinks, and it does so across every major coding agent at once — Claude Code, Cursor, Amazon Q, Google Antigravity, Windsurf, Augment. HalluSquatting registers the package names LLMs reliably hallucinate; there is no patch, only mitigation, because hallucination is a property of the model rather than a defect in it. A DNS-based injection ships payloads through TXT records that never appear in source, so static analysis sees nothing. And GitHub's own AI agent leaked private repositories after a prompt injection. That last one is the tell. If one of the most sophisticated engineering organizations on earth cannot hold the line, the line is in the wrong place.

    Detection does not close the gap. Sophos found that legitimate agents trip the same endpoint rules as human intruders, which means each agent a company adds quietly lowers its own signal-to-noise. Offense scales the other direction. One researcher's autonomous hunting rig, running on a few hundred dollars a month, produced verified CVEs in Go's standard library and chained 0-days to SYSTEM. The Exploitarium dump released 130+ zero-day PoCs against Docker, OpenVPN Connect, and libssh2 with no vendor notification. Eight AI/ML frameworks, Langflow, Crawl4AI, and LLaMA-Factory among them, carry CVSS 9.8-10.0 pre-auth RCE this week alone.

    Second-Order Effects

    The real gap is governance. IAM was built for humans and static service accounts, and an agent is neither, which is why the proposed 6-stage non-human-identity maturity model concedes the industry is starting at zero. Amazon rejects human-in-the-loop approval outright, on the theory that approval fatigue is itself the vulnerability, and prefers three-layer automated scoping: static guardrails, per-agent maximum privilege, dynamic per-task policy. Google lands in the same place, with fleets overseen by humans rather than approved by them. Regulators have noticed. The ECB gave banks four months to produce AI-attack defense plans, and those obligations reach vendors within two or three quarters.

    The Decision

    A skeptic will say this is a hardening problem that a patch cycle solves. It is not. Approval-based oversight fails at machine speed in both directions. Attacks land faster than humans triage, and agents act faster than humans review. That makes it an architecture decision, and this quarter's choice sets the blast radius for next year's.

    The Bottom Line — The tools you bought for developer productivity are now your fastest-growing attack surface, and no identity system you own can govern them.

  3. 03

    The Review Gate Collapsed in 30 Days — Rebuild Quality for Machine-Authored Code

    monitor

    The jump from 10% to 40% unreviewed AI commits took a single month, and the timing is the tell: it tracks the latest model releases crossing the quality threshold where developers rationally stopped checking. That's the danger — not laziness fixable by memo, but individually rational behavior compounding into systemic risk. Every quality gate, security scan, and architectural review you run was designed for human-authored code reviewed by humans. That world ended last month.

    The productivity distribution is equally destabilizing. A 45x gap between top-1% and median AI-assisted developers — 10x between p90 and p50 — means developer value has shifted from coding ability to AI orchestration ability, and linear headcount-based capacity planning no longer describes reality. Corroboration: a single developer used frontier models to rewrite the Bun JavaScript runtime from Zig to Rust — scoped at a small team for a year — and the multi-agent version ran 64 parallel instances to completion in 11 days. If you're carrying technical debt or planning platform migrations, your timelines are wrong by 3-5x.

    Second-Order Effects

    Two consequences. First, the highest-ROI training investment is moving median developers toward the 90th percentile of AI fluency — a 10x output delta from process and tooling, not hiring. Second, the dominant coding platform's context caching creates a 10x cost moat that makes building equivalent tooling internally irrational, while its proprietary model — 5x better cost-per-line-accepted than frontier alternatives — is a deliberate AWS-style play to capture both tool and model margin. Buy the platform, but negotiate as if lock-in is the product, because it is.

    The Decision

    1. Velocity without machine-adapted assurance is deferred incident cost — fund the gates before the debt surfaces.
    2. Reframe hiring and compensation around AI orchestration fluency, not language expertise.
    The Bottom Line — Your engineers rationally stopped reviewing machine-written code the moment it got good enough, and your quality infrastructure hasn't noticed yet.

  4. 04

    Power Sovereignty Is the New Moat — and the Financing Window Is Narrowing From Both Ends

    monitor

    The simultaneity is what's new. Anthropic's $19B, 20-year lease with TeraWulf and Meta's $9.1B dedicated 932MW gas plant in Alberta declare shared grid capacity insufficient for AI-scale operations — the leaders are exiting the grid market entirely. Same news cycle: the Hormuz closure pushed Brent up 7.6% in a day, CPI printed a three-year high at 4.2%, and the FOMC split moved to 9 of 18 favoring hikes under the new chair. Power and capital — the two inputs that set AI unit economics — are inflating at once, while the largest buyers lock up supply for two decades.

    Memory confirms the squeeze is structural, not cyclical: Sandisk +575% and Micron +214% on the year, SK Hynix raising $26B for capacity — and the shortage still has an estimated 18-24 months to run. A 12-year-old memory controller company (ScaleFlux) targeting a multi-billion-dollar IPO says the entire hardware value chain has repriced, not just GPUs. 2027-2028 infrastructure budgets modeled on 2024 costs are materially wrong today.

    Second-Order Effects

    Capital cuts both ways: fundraising remains exuberant, but Morgan Stanley is publicly warning that Big Tech AI debt is underpriced, and a hawkish Fed repricing growth equity would close the window abruptly. The read is narrow: conditions for raising capital and locking supply are as good now as they get this cycle — and the leaders are behaving as if they know it.

    The Decision

    1. Decide which layer of the stack you must own or have guaranteed access to — compute, power, or neither — and secure it while counterparties still negotiate.
    2. Stress-test against a 50-75bps hike scenario and identify refinancing trigger points before the market does.
    The Bottom Line — The AI leaders just locked in their power and compute for twenty years; everyone who didn't will be renting from them at whatever the shortage prices in.

Frequently asked

Why can't the Data Privacy Framework be patched like Safe Harbor and Privacy Shield were?
Prior invalidations were repaired through executive orders and administrative rebrands, but this failure is constitutional. The Supreme Court ruled that the statutory independence protecting FTC commissioners is unconstitutional, while EU treaty law requires oversight by genuinely independent authorities. That's a direct conflict between US constitutional law and EU adequacy requirements, and no executive action can bridge it. A congressional fix reconstructing agency independence is highly improbable.
Do Standard Contractual Clauses or Binding Corporate Rules offer a safe fallback?
They buy time, not immunity. SCCs and BCRs inherit the same US surveillance-law objections that killed Safe Harbor and Privacy Shield, so they are vulnerable to the same CJEU challenges. Treat them as a bridge for a 6-month contingency window while you stand up EU regional infrastructure, not as a permanent architecture.
What trigger events should we monitor to activate the no-DPF contingency?
Track the Schrems-led CJEU challenge to the DPF and the reconstitution of the PCLOB, which has lacked a quorum since January 2025 and oversees the Data Protection Review Court. A CJEU invalidation ruling arrives with no grace period — the 2020 Privacy Shield collapse punished companies that hadn't pre-built plans. Design the contingency to be executable within six months of a court decision.
